The Ethno-Centre Balkanika will continue its work at the primary schools in Tetovo
"We grow up together" in four primary schools
Two hundred pupils from the primary schools "Kiril i Metodij", "Istigbal", "Andrej Saveski - Kikis", and "Goce Delcev" from Tetovo will be involved in the continuation of the project "We grow up together" implemented by the Ethno Centre Balkanika from Tetovo and the NGO Forum - ZDF from Bonn.
"We grow up together" is a continuation of the pilot-project that was being implemented only at the primary school "Kiril i Metodij". The project is still focused on the peaceful ways of conflict resolution, reduction of the children's aggressive behaviour, respecting the differences, development of defensive mechanism against frustration, development of the pupils' capacities for mutual living in different ethnic and age groups, development of the pupils' imagination and creativity, introducing methods of recognizing conflicts and non-aggressive methods of their resolution. Besides the pupils, the project includes the teachers and the parents.
The pupils will be engaged in activities in the field of environment and sport, in creative workshops and workshops for introducing the techniques of communication. In the moths for introducing the terms discrimination and conflict, the students will be explained the most common sources of discrimination.
The project is supported by the German Federal Government as a sponsor, the Stability Pact for Eastern and South - Eastern Europe and the Caritas office, France.
